Letter from Lewis Tappan, New York, to Amos Augustus Phelps, 1847 February 5

In this letter to Amos A. Phelps, Lewis Tappan discusses Phelps’s failing health. He then talks about the good work Mr. Whipple is doing with the “American Missionary” in spite of the trouble Charles Steward Renshaw is making, and the progress made with the Washington paper. H...
